CVE-2026-61548: rsyslog mmpstrucdata stack overflow

Affected Software

2 affected componentsFixes available
rsyslog Rsyslog
debian/rsyslog<=8.2102.0-2+deb11u1, <=8.2302.0-1+deb12u1, <=8.2504.0-1
8.2606.0-4

Remediation

Recommended actions to resolve this vulnerability, in priority order.

  1. Upgrade

    Upgrade debian/rsyslog to a version that resolves this vulnerability.

    Fixed in 8.2606.0-4
